Beenda

Beenda is a village located in Aklera tehsil of Jhalawar district in Rajasthan, India. It is situated 8km away from sub-district headquarter Aklera (tehsildar office) and 62km away from district headquarter Jhalawar. As per 2009 stats, Deori Kalan is the gram panchayat of Beenda village.

About Beenda

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Beenda is 104451. The village spans a total geographical area of 350.42 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 326033. Aklera is nearest town to Beenda village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 8km away.

When it comes to local governance, Beenda village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Manohar thana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Jhalawar-Baran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Beenda

Below is a concise population overview of Beenda as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 949 472 477
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 137 72 65
Scheduled Castes (SC) 77 39 38
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 704 349 355
Literate Population 468 301 167
Illiterate Population 481 171 310

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Beenda village:

  • The total population of Beenda village is around 949, including approximately 472 males and 477 females, with a sex ratio of 1010 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 137 children aged 0–6 years in Beenda village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Beenda village has 77 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 704 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Beenda village is about 49.32%, with male literacy at 63.77% and female literacy at 35.01%.
  • There are around 195 households in Beenda village.

Connectivity of Beenda

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Beenda. As per the 2011 stats, Beenda had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
